About azulene-1-carbaldehyde

azulene-1-carbaldehyde (PubChem CID 11744870) has the molecular formula C11H8O and a molecular weight of 156.18 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is azulene-1-carbaldehyde.

What are the key properties of azulene-1-carbaldehyde?
azulene-1-carbaldehyde has a molecular weight of 156.18 g/mol, XLogP of 2.60, 1 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 1 hydrogen bond acceptors.
